The Winter Cleaning Challenge — How Cold Weather Fuels Indoor Contamination

When the cold season sets in, windows close, heaters run nonstop, and air circulation slows.

While this keeps us warm, it also traps pollutants & pathogens indoors — creating the ideal environment for dust, dirt, and dander to accumulate. Winter introduces a silent enemy - poor air quality caused by decreased ventilation and cleaning frequency. Throughout winter, tracked-in debris such as salt, soil, and slush break down into fine dust that embeds itself in carpets, furniture, and air vents along with external pathogens and germs being harbored and carried throughout your space. Each time the heater cycles on, it stirs up these particles, germs, and, pathogens, releasing allergens and microorganisms back into the air.


According to the EPA, indoor air during winter can be up to five times more polluted than outdoor air. With reduced fresh air exchange and infrequent deep cleaning, pollutants such as mold spores, bacteria, VOCs, and pet dander multiply. Over time, this can trigger headaches, fatigue, sinus irritation, and worsen allergies or asthma.


Poor indoor air quality can contribute to health issues such as fatigue, headaches, coughing, eye irritation, and asthma episodes, especially for those with existing respiratory conditions, says the American Lung Association and the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ency

Neglected HVAC systems compound the issue — clogged filters and dirty ducts continuously circulate contaminants. The combination of dry indoor air and poor cleaning routines can quickly transform a cozy space into a breeding ground for germs and irritants.

Poor Air Quality — The Hidden Health Threat Indoors During Winter

During the winter months, closed environments and heating systems trap microscopic pollutants and recirculate them through the air. Dry air from constant heating reduces humidity, leading to respiratory irritation and increased viral survival rates. Studies show that flu viruses live longer in dry indoor environments, making homes and workplaces prime carriers of illness.


When humidity drops below 30%, nasal membranes dry out, weakening natural defenses. This makes it easier for viruses such as RSV, influenza, and the common cold to spread. Meanwhile, unclean HVAC systems distribute dust, pet dander, and bacteria every time the heat turns on.


The impact of poor air quality goes beyond physical health — it affects cognitive performance, focus, and comfort. In offices and schools, it leads to fatigue and absenteeism; at home, it causes sleep disturbances and chronic congestion.


How to Improve Indoor Air Quality During Winter

  • Replace HVAC filters every 30–60 days.

  • Use humidifiers to maintain 40–60% humidity.

  • Add HEPA air purifiers in bedrooms and common areas.

  • Ventilate rooms briefly each day to refresh trapped air.

  • Schedule professional duct cleaning to remove buildup.


Investing in air quality maintenance during winter protects against illness, enhances comfort, and supports overall well-being. Clean air is the foundation of a healthy home or business environment.


High-Touch Surfaces — The Silent Spreaders of Germs and Viruses


During colder months, shared surfaces become powerful transmitters of bacteria and viruses. From door handles and light switches to office keyboards and phones, every contact can spread germs. Research confirms that influenza viruses can survive up to 48 hours on nonporous surfaces, making regular disinfection & sanitation essential.


Most people underestimate how frequently they touch contaminated surfaces. Without consistent cleaning, one infected individual can unknowingly spread germs to everyone in the building within hours. Standard wipes may remove dirt, but without proper dwell time — the contact period needed for disinfectants to kill microbes — many pathogens remain active.

Winter maintenance isn’t a spring-cleaning substitute — it’s a defense strategy. Dust buildup, stagnant air, and uncleaned HVAC systems make spaces more susceptible to allergens and bacteria. A proactive cleaning plan helps prevent problems before they begin.


Residential Proactive Cleaning Checklist

  • Vacuum carpets and upholstery with HEPA vacuums weekly

  • Wash curtains and bedding every two weeks

  • Dust ceiling fans, vents, and shelves regularly

  • Clean humidifiers to prevent mold growth

  • Disinfect high-touch points daily
